What is Spotify's mission statement?

Spotify's mission statement is "to unlock the potential of human creativity by giving a million creative artists the opportunity to live off their art and billions of fans the opportunity to enjoy and be inspired by these creators." The mission statement sheds more light on the goals of the company and how it wants these goals to become a reality.

What is Spotify's vision statement?

Spotify's Vision Statement The vision of Spotify is : “We envision a cultural platform where professional creators can break free of their medium's constraints and where everyone can enjoy an immersive artistic experience that enables us to empathize with each other and to feel part of a greater whole.”

What are Spotify's core values?

Spotify's core values include “passionate, innovative, sincere, collaborative, and playful.” These values are what the corporation considers as the guiding principles that keep everything within the expectations of the management.

What is the main business focus for Spotify?

Discovery is Spotify's superpower. As elucidated in its IPO filing documents (F-1), Spotify has always understood that its primary mission is to serve as a portal to music discovery. Playlists are the backbone of Spotify's discovery focused UX with over four billion playlists on its platform.

What is Spotify's strategy?

Spotify operates with a broad differentiation generic strategy by offering a wide range of music that appeals to a large market of listeners and differentiates itself by providing personalized playlists and music recommendations to users.

What is Spotify's vision?

Compared to the corporate mission, Spotify’s vision statement is a relatively abstract perspective on the nature of the business, especially in terms of how it affects two of the major stakeholder groups, namely , the creators and the consumers of digital content. The vision’s emphasis on culture is an indicator of how Spotify sees its position not just in the global on-demand streaming music industry and market, but also in the world’s society. The corporation aims to promote empathic and harmonious relations for the global community. This business nature consideration in the corporate vision statement is a reflection of the business model and strategies of Spotify Technology S.A. For example, the company’s model as a platform business supports cultural exchange among customers. The corporate vision also relates to Spotify’s corporate culture in the aspect of human resource management that allows employees’ cultural backgrounds to influence the administration of the company’s curated playlists.

What is Spotify's corporate vision?

Spotify’s corporate vision is to be “ a cultural platform where professional creators can break free of their medium’s constraints and where everyone can enjoy an immersive artistic experience that enables us to empathize with each other and to feel part of a greater whole .” The company’s nature as a platform, and the metaphysical value of the music streaming business are specified in this corporate vision statement. In essence, Spotify considers itself as a promoter of international societal improvement via cultural relations.

What is Spotify code?from en.wikipedia.org

In May 2017, Spotify introduced Spotify Codes for its mobile apps, a way for users to share specific artists, tracks, playlists or albums with other people. Users find the relevant content to share and press a "soundwave-style barcode" on the display.

What is the name of the podcast that Spotify acquired?from en.wikipedia.org

On 12 April 2018, Spotify acquired the music licensing platform Loudr. On 6 February 2019, Spotify acquired the podcast networks Gimlet Media and Anchor FM Inc., with the goal of establishing themselves as a leading figure in podcasting. On 26 March, Spotify announced they would acquire another podcast network, Parcast. On 12 September, Spotify acquired SoundBetter, a music production marketplace for people in the music industry to collaborate on projects, and distribute music tracks for licensing.

What companies does Spotify own?from en.wikipedia.org

In May 2013, Spotify acquired music discovery app Tunigo. In March 2014, they acquired The Echo Nest, a music intelligence company. In June 2015, Spotify announced they had acquired Seed Scientific, a data science consulting firm and analytics company. In a comment to TechCrunch, Spotify said that Seed Scientific's team would lead an Advanced Analytics unit within the company focused on developing data services. In January 2016, they acquired social and messaging startups Cord Project and Soundwave, followed in April 2016 by CrowdAlbum, a "startup that collects photos and videos of performances shared on social networks," and would "enhance the development of products that help artists understand, activate, and monetize their audiences". In November 2016, Spotify acquired Preact, a "cloud-based platform and service developed for companies that operate on subscription models which helps reduce churn and build up their subscriber numbers".

How does Spotify improve lives?

Improving lives. Spotify satisfies this feature by being an interactive and up-to-date platform that its users can depend on. The company acknowledges how critical digital space is for its target audience in creating sustainable livelihoods for themselves. Within Spotify’s platform, for instance, artists have a better chance of reaching out to a wider fan base. The targeting criteria used by the company ensures that the digital content created by an artist reaches the most appropriate audience, making it profitable for these individuals. In fact, this echoes what the mission statement means by enabling the artists ‘to live off their art.’

What is the difference between a mission statement and a vision statement?

All this growth has been due to these two corporate statements together with the core values of the company. A corporate vision statement is all about what the business target the management of the company wants to achieve, while a corporate mission statement basically defines the operations that a business embarks on to meet its objectives. Spotify’s vision statement emphasizes how influential the company is in matters related to digital content exchanges and how it enriches this.
